1 hour to prepare serves 24

INGREDIENTS

Cookies:
1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
3/4 cup (1 1/2 sticks) unsalted butter, at room temperature
1/2 cup of sugar
1/2 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ips, melted
1 large egg
1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t

Icing:
2 cups of powdered sugar
1/2 cup (1 stick) unsalted butter, at room temperature
1/4 cup of milk
2 tablespoons of cocoa powder
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

PREPARATION

Preheat the oven to 350º and line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per.
In a large bowl or in a mixer, spread the butter and sugar for 3-4 minutes, or until fluffy and light in color.
Mix in the egg, then, once incorporated, add the vanilla extract.
In a medium bowl, mix the flour, baking powder and salt, then gradually add the dry ingredients into the wet one.
Fold in the melted chocolate until well combined.
Using a tablespoon or small ice cream scoop, drop small spoonfuls of dough on the lined baking sheets.
Place the tray in the oven and bake the cookies for 9-10 minutes, or until they settle on the outside but are still soft inside.
Remove from the oven and let them cool completely.
While baking the cookies, make the glaze by mixing the butter, milk, cocoa powder and vanilla extract in a medium saucepan over medium heat.
Once melted and smooth, remove the pan from the heat and add the powdered sugar until smooth.
Pour the icing over the cooled cookies and let them rest.
